Date: 4-7-2004 Wrote: EP's reporter Ahmed Abo El Dahab
According to some Egyptian papers, Cairo giants Al-Ahly
offered a contract to the Swedish/Egyptian keeper Rami
Shaaban who is currently available as free agent.
Cairo giants Al-Ahly as currently looking
for an experienced goalkeeper. The current main keeper
Essam El Hadary wasn't at his best this season and the
youngster Sherif Ikrami may be on his way to Europe
soon.
Some Egyptian papers stated that Al-Ahly
made an offer for Rami. However, the exact outcome of
the negotiations between Ahly and player is yet to be
known.
It should be mentioned that the Egyptian/Swedish
shot stopper was released
by Arsenal together with 16 more players including
the Nigerian striker Kanu.
